WebAnother way to describe the variation of a test is calculate the coefficient of variation, or CV. The CV expresses the variation as a percentage of the mean, and is calculated as follows: CV% = (SD/Xbar)100 In the laboratory, the CV is preferred when the SD increases in proportion to concentration.

WebIt wouldn't make sense to compare the SD of blood pressure with the SD of pulse rate, but it might make sense to compare the two CV values. Notes: • It only makes sense to report CV for variables, such as mass or enzyme activity, where “0.0” is defined to really mean zero. A weight of zero means no weight. WebIt is also called unitized risk or the variation coefficient. The coefficient of variation is defined as the ratio of the standard deviation to the mean: Where: c v = coefficient of variation. σ = population standard deviation. x 1, ..., x N = the population data set. μ = mean of the population data set.

The coefficient of variation (CV) is defined as the ratio of the standard deviation $${\displaystyle \ \sigma }$$ to the mean $${\displaystyle \ \mu }$$, $${\displaystyle c_{\rm {v}}={\frac {\sigma }{\mu }}.}$$ It shows the extent of variability in relation to the mean of the population. WebPercentage Difference Formula: Percentage difference equals the absolute value of the change in value, divided by the average of the 2 numbers, all multiplied by 100. We then append the percent sign, %, to designate the % difference.
